Understanding Golf Headcovers
Golf headcovers are protective sleeves that fit over the heads of golf clubs. Traditionally, they were made from wool or leather, but modern headcovers come in a variety of materials such as synthetic fibers, neoprene, and even plush fabrics. Their primary function is to shield clubs from damage during transport and storage, but they also offer a chance for personal expression.
The Importance of Golf Headcovers
1. Protection: The primary purpose of a headcover is to protect the club head from physical damage. Golf clubs, especially drivers, can be quite expensive, so safeguarding them is crucial for maintaining their performance.
2. Organization: Many golfers use headcovers to differentiate between clubs in their bag. This can be particularly helpful during a game when quick identification is necessary.
3. Personal Expression: Golf headcovers can reflect a golfer’s personality, interests, or affiliations. With countless patterns and designs available, players can choose headcovers that resonate with their style.
4. Identifying Your Gear: Custom headcovers can help prevent mix-ups on the course, especially during tournaments or when playing with friends.

Material Choices for Headcovers
The material of a golf headcover greatly influences its durability, appearance, and protective qualities. Here are some common materials and their benefits:
1. Wool
Wool headcovers have a classic appeal and excellent cushioning properties. They provide good protection against scratches and are often associated with traditional golfing attire.
2. Leather
Leather headcovers exude luxury and durability. They are resistant to wear and tear but may require more maintenance to keep them looking their best.
3. Neoprene
Neoprene is a synthetic material that offers flexibility and water resistance. These headcovers are lightweight and provide excellent protection against the elements.
4. Synthetic Fabrics
Various synthetic fabrics are used in modern headcovers, offering a balance of durability, color options, and affordability. They often come in a range of patterns and designs, making them a popular choice.

Care and Maintenance of Golf Headcovers
To ensure the longevity of your golf headcovers, proper care and maintenance are essential. Here are some tips:
1. Regular Cleaning
- Wool and Fabric Headcovers: Hand wash gently with mild detergent and air dry to maintain their shape and prevent shrinkage.
- Leather Headcovers: Wipe down with a damp cloth and use a leather conditioner occasionally to keep the material supple.
2. Store Properly
When not in use, store headcovers in a cool, dry place. Avoid folding or compressing them, as this can lead to misshaping.
3. Inspect for Damage
Regularly check your headcovers for signs of wear and tear. Addressing small issues early can prevent more significant damage down the line.
